Selaa lähdekoodia

fixed headers issue

Former-commit-id: 9571104ddc1c97887d14d7ec7cda7adc68e5d6e3
Gildas 6 vuotta sitten
vanhempi
sitoutus
0ced34ee12
1 muutettua tiedostoa jossa 8 lisäystä ja 1 poistoa
  1. 8 1
      extension/lib/fetch/content/content-fetch-resources.js

+ 8 - 1
extension/lib/fetch/content/content-fetch-resources.js

@@ -74,7 +74,14 @@ this.singlefile.extension.lib.fetch.content.resources = this.singlefile.extensio
 			const response = await sendMessage({ method: "fetch.frame", url, frameId });
 			return {
 				status: response.status,
-				headers: { get: headerName => response.headers[headerName] },
+				headers: {
+					get: headerName => {
+						const headerArray = response.headers.find(headerArray => headerArray[0] == headerName);
+						if (headerArray) {
+							return headerArray[1];
+						}
+					}
+				},
 				arrayBuffer: async () => new Uint8Array(response.array).buffer
 			};
 		}